Australian producers are faced with a myriad of risk factors to their livestock on a daily basis, impacting the productivity, health and success of their properties. Biosecurity is a set of measures designed to protect farms from the spread of pests and disease. Biosecurity is the responsibility of every farmer, and that of every person visiting or working on the property.


Farm Biosecurity is implemented by all good producers and may include initiatives such as appropriate boundary fencing or testing for disease before purchasing and introducing new animals to the herd.

One Biosecurity

In South Australia, the Department of Primary Industries and Regions (PIRSA) promotes farm biosecurity through the livestock biosecurity assurance program, One Biosecurity. One Biosecurity is an online tool where producers can manage, check and declare their farm biosecurity status for a range of endemic diseases.

One Biosecurity provides best practice biosecurity assessment, management, advice and guidelines for multiple livestock diseases in South Australia. Endemic disease control is an important component of the program and laboratory testing is vital to provide evidence of a producer’s property status regarding risk for the endemic diseases, including:

  • Sheep - Johne's Disease, Footrot, Lice, Ovine Brucellosis
  • Dairy Cattle - Johne's Disease, Pestivirus
  • Beef Cattle - Johne's Disease, Pestivirus

Surveillance Programs

In surveillance programs, samples are tested as part of investigation of disease events in case they are the result of breaches in biosecurity. In monitoring programs regularly collected samples from the herd and environment are tested for early detection of pathogens before disease is apparent. The property’s animals are sampled individually, or in groups where samples may be pooled. Environmental sampling might involve testing of water, air, feed or slurry.

Notifiable Disease Reporting

A number of animal diseases are notifiable, and they pose a real threat to Australia’s animal health status. A notifiable disease must be reported immediately to:

  • Emergency Animal Disease Watch hotline on 1800 675 888
  • your nearest government animal health adviser or government veterinary officer.
